Police keen to speak to man after three teenage girls assaulted on Lanarkshire bus

Police Scotland are appealing following a report of three teenage girls being assaulted on a Lanarkshire bus.The incident happened between 7.10pm and 7.30pm between High Blantyre and Calderwood Expressway, on Sunday, October, 22.Officers are keen to speak to a man who got on the bus going from Blantyre to East Kilbride at that time.The Lanarkshire Live app is available to download now.
